Y-chromosomal DNA variation in Pakistan

Summary
This study analyzed Y-chromosome DNA from 718 Pakistani men across 12 ethnic groups. Findings reveal genetic similarities with neighbors but also distinct population substructures and support specific historical origins, like the Parsis from Iran.

Background:
- The Y chromosome, inherited paternally, offers insights into male lineage and population history.
- Pakistan's diverse ethnic landscape presents a unique opportunity to study human migration and genetic admixture.
- Understanding Y-chromosome variation aids in reconstructing historical population movements and validating oral traditions.
Purpose of the Study:
- To characterize the Y-chromosome genetic diversity across 12 major ethnic groups in Pakistan.
- To identify stable haplogroups and haplotypes within the Pakistani male population.
- To compare genetic patterns with neighboring regions and investigate congruence with historical narratives.
Main Methods:
- Typing of 18 binary polymorphisms and 16 short-tandem-repeat (STR) loci on the nonrecombining Y chromosome.
- Analysis of 718 male subjects representing 12 distinct ethnic groups from Pakistan.
- Construction of median-joining networks to visualize haplotype relationships and population substructure.
Main Results:
- Identification of 11 stable haplogroups and 503 unique binary marker/STR haplotypes.
- Observed haplogroup frequencies largely mirrored those in adjacent geographical areas.
- Significant Y-chromosome substructuring was evident within Pakistan, with distinct haplotype clusters in various populations, suggesting isolation and genetic drift.
Conclusions:
- Pakistani populations, regardless of linguistic background, show genetic resemblance to the broader Indo-European speaking groups.
- Y-chromosome data support specific historical origins, including Parsis (Iran), Hazaras (Genghis Khan's army), and Makrani (Africa).
- Genetic evidence does not corroborate oral traditions suggesting Tibetan, Syrian, Greek, or Jewish origins for certain Pakistani groups.
